Post by Chill » Thu Jun 10, 2004 8:08 am

There are already about a bizillion tradeskill macros, are you really sure you want to reinvent a new one?

My first question, is why are you tradeskilling? For items for for skillups?

There are macros already that will keep track of your skill and even stop you when somehting becomes trivial. I wrote one that will tell my my success and fail rates. There are some that will do sub combines and such. Check the Macro Depot and do some searches man.

If none of these meet your needs, then I would suggest changing your /click left 560,480 to /notify COMBW_CombineArea CombineButton leftmouseup as a start so it doesnt break if you move the box.

Post by Fuergrissa » Thu Jun 10, 2004 9:39 am

apart from the good working macros already out there including Mine what happens when it returns after you autoinv your cursor.

Code: Select all

Sub Main 
   /call DoCombine 
   /delay 5 
   /call DelayTimer 
   /delay 5 
   /call DoAutoInv 
/endmacro 
and why

Code: Select all

   /delay 5 
   /call DelayTimer 
   /delay 5 
call 3 delays to do one job ? why not just use /delay 60 if you feel a need to have a delay for that long ?
